Three Data-backed Strategies to Reduce Restaurant Operating Costs Without Sacrificing Service Quality

Modern Restaurant Management

Replacing a front-of-house employee costs an average of $1,056, while back-of-house replacement jumps to $1,491. Management replacement is even more expensive at $2,611 per position—nearly 150 percent higher than front-of-house costs. Revisit when you’re busiest, and reassign your team based on demand.
